#123d6b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#123d6b is composed of 7.1% red, 23.9%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.2% cyan, 43% magenta, 0%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 211 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 24.5%. #123d6b color hex could be obtained by blending #247ad6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#123d6b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#123d6b has RGB values of R:18, G:61,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 1195371.

Shades and Tints of #123d6b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#123d6b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3e40 is the less saturated color, while #043d79 is the most saturated one.
